#5BB520 Hex Color Code

#5BB520

The Hexadecimal Color #5BB520 is a contrast shade of Olive Drab. #5BB520 RGB value is rgb(91, 181, 32). RGB Color Model of #5BB520 consists of 35% red, 70% green and 12% blue. HSL color Mode of #5BB520 has 96°(degrees) Hue, 70%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#5BB520 color has an wavelength of 559.55556n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#5BB520 is #66CC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#5BB520 is #5B2. The Closest Color to #5BB520 is #6B8E23. Official Name of #5BB520 Hex Code is Apple.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#5BB520 is 50 Cyan 0 Magenta 82 Yellow 29 Black and #5BB520 CMY is 50, 0, 82.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#5BB520 is hsl(96,70,42,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(96, 82, 71).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#5BB520 is 21.1, 35.37, 7.08.
Hex8 Value of #5BB520 is #5BB520FF. Decimal Value of #5BB520 is 6010144 and Octal Value of #5BB520 is 26732440. Binary Value of #5BB520 is 1011011, 10110101, 100000 and Android of #5BB520 is 4284200224 / 0xff5bb520.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#5BB520 is 0.332, 0.557, 0.557 and YIQ Color Space of #5BB520 is 137.104, -5.7573, -65.4038.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#5BB520 is 29.51, 45.24, 7.51.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#5BB520 is 66.04, -50.85, 61.02.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#5BB520 is 66.04, -43.37, 74.95.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#5BB520 is 66.04, 79.43, 129.81. Hunter Lab variable of #5BB520 is 59.47, -40.75, 34.57.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#5BB520

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
